Museums and Art Galleries
Pay homage to the rich cultural history of Australia by stopping at the Aboriginal Heritage Office. If you prefer interactive historical sites, this attraction is perfect for you. In addition to enjoying the museum itself, you can book an Aboriginal site tour or attend a presentation. You could also take a 10-minute walk and explore one of the most popular art museums in Australia: the Art Gallery of New South Wales. Guided tours are available daily.

Kid-Friendly Attractions
Sydney has a lot to offer kids, too. Your travel agent will likely recommend the aquarium in Darling Harbor, which is home to thousands of colorful marine animals. Youngsters will also enjoy the Taronga Zoo, which overlooks the Harbour Bridge and Sydney Cove. Your child can even enter some of the enclosures with a ranger’s assistance and have his or her picture taken with the native fauna.
